They Accepted my Offer to Buy a Home, Now What? 
 
Looking to Buy a Home in Arizona?  Now you have an accepted purchase contract!  Hurray!  So what's next?  In Arizona, it's all spelled out in the contract but the following is a summary.  
 
Opening escrow needs to be done within the first three business days of contract acceptance.   The title company is selected during the contract negotiations, so that's where a check is either delivered or funds are wired.  The amount you elected to offer as earnest money is listed on page one of your contract.  
 
Once escrow is open, the title company will issue a Title Commitment report.  That report will reflect liens on the property, if there are any judgements, or any "clouds" on title that might need to be managed before this sale can close.   The title company will answer any questions you have and if there are liens, will work to eliminate them to help the sale close.
